Sakari Ramen serves up quick, flavorful bowls of miso and tonkatsu in a bustling food court, perfect for cozy bites on the go.

Really delicious ramen located in the new food court at Asia Times Square. My wife and I tried the Tonkatsu Ramen and Chicken Karaage. Food came out fast and presentation was clean. The Karaage batter was a bit different from others we've tried in the past. It was more dense but well seasoned and served with a delicate dipping mayo type sauce with scallions on top. About 5/6 pieces in the order. The Tonkatsu Ramen is their most popular and deservingly so. The smell of it once it was delivered to our table was exquisite on a cold evening. I ordered mine with #3 spicey - apparently you can choose 1-5. It was great. It would be great if it were cheaper but the price doesn't hurt that bad for what you get.
